Abstract

The proposed project would consist of the design and construction of a pedestrian bridge over State Route (SR) 21 in Port Wentworth. It will also include construction of a sidewalk up to the nearest intersection of Rice Mill Road/SR 21. The pedestrian crossing will serve the population of a growing residential neighborhood and a new school. Residents will be able to use the crossing to safely cross SR 21 to take their children to school, and access goods and services provided by Rice Hope and Rice Creek developments. The project will be constructed using a Design-Build process. Minor additional required right-of-way (ROW) is anticipated within the APE.
